Back and neck pain
Whether it’s upper, lower, or in the midback, the actual source or cause of back pain may not be apparent. Often, the non-painful dysfunctional regions cause pain in the functional regions. Symptoms are often insidious or present with certain movements such as prolonged running, cycling, or a combination of activities.
